Dr. Lynn Baldwin: After practicing as a registered nurse for over ten years, Lynn L. Baldwin went on to the Medical College of Wisconsin, graduating with a Doctor of Medicine degree in 1989. Dr Baldwin completed her residency in Family Medicine at St MichaelÃÂ's Hospital in 1992. She holds board certification through the American Board of Integrative, Holistic Medicine. Before devoting her full time to cancer nutrition and advocacy, Dr Baldwin had been a consulting physician in Integrative Medicine at Wellness Connection in Wales, Wisconsin. She has extensive post-graduate education and experience in nutrition, herbal medicine, mind-body therapies and has completed the Cancer Guide Professional Training through the Center for Mind-Body Medicine. In addition, Dr Baldwin is Reiki III Master Level trained. Dr Baldwin is a member and past-president of the Waukesha Medical Society, past delegate to the State Medical Society, prior Integrative Medicine board member at Westwood Health and Fitness, and served on the Expert Panel of the WomenÃÂ's Health Foundation (founded by Sue Ann Thompson). Whether developing individual health strategies or educating her clients, Dr. Baldwin takes a proactive approach in managing their wellness needs. She views herself as bridging the gap between conventional and complementary medicine and believes good health is a function of physical, emotional, spiritual and mental factors. In addition to her private cancer advocacy practice, Dr Baldwin is a frequently requested speaker at workshops, seminars, retreats and specialty group meetings. She has been quoted in several lay press articles on integrative approaches to health care and womenÃÂ's midlife issues.
